Publication number: 20220087287Abstract: An apparatus for and method of steam treatment of fodder, for example animal fodder which is typically in baled form. The purpose of steam treating is to kill mesophilic and thermophilic mould spores that are either attached to the fodder or detach when disturbed and become airborne. These airborne particles are associated with respiratory problems, infections and allergies to livestock as well as humans. The apparatus for steam treating fodder comprises at least one steam distribution manifold, which has a plurality of lances adapted to penetrate a bale of fodder so that steam is supplied to the interior volume of the fodder.Type: ApplicationFiled: December 2, 2021Publication date: March 24, 2022Applicant: HAYGAIN LTDInventors: Brian Gordon FILLERY, Timothy Michael OLIVER

Patent number: 10844777Abstract: An electronic compressor bypass valve (eCBV) module includes a pedestal housing, and a compressor bypass valve mounted to the pedestal housing. An inlet port, a first outlet port, and a second outlet port are integrally formed as part of the pedestal housing, where pressurized air flows into the inlet port. The eCBV module also includes a venturi device at least partially disposed in the second outlet port. When the compressor bypass valve is in an open position, a portion of the pressurized air flows through the first outlet port, and a portion of the pressurized air flows from the inlet port through the venturi device and through the second outlet port. When the compressor bypass valve is in the closed position the pressurized air is prevented from flowing into the first outlet port, and all of the pressurized air flows through the venturi device and through the second outlet port.Type: GrantFiled: March 25, 2019Date of Patent: November 24, 2020Assignee: Continental Powertrain USA, LLCInventors: Ravinder Singh Gill, Brian Gordon Woods, Benjamin Dominick Manton Williams, Jaime Altes Sosa, David Rene Forgeron, Daniel Clayton Todd Jackson

Patent number: 9683523Abstract: A vapor purge system having a tank isolation valve and a canister vent valve, where each valve includes a latching mechanism for maintaining the valves in an open position, and a diagnostic test is performed on the purge system to prove that each of the valves are functioning correctly. Using latching valves in these applications reduces electricity draw from the battery and reduces electrical interference with integrated pressure sensors. The fuel tank is sealed by the tank isolation valve between the fuel tank and a vapor storage canister, and the canister vent valve provides sealing between the canister and the atmosphere, and controls venting of the canister. The diagnostic test is performed using the tank isolation valve and the canister vent valve under different operating conditions.Type: GrantFiled: September 11, 2014Date of Patent: June 20, 2017Assignee: Continental Automotive Systems, Inc.Inventors: David William Balsdon, Brian Gordon Woods
